Transaction

2d4420cdf6800be1e69316a1234f9af1a5d6eefd4186ae425098496e8e0826a8

Summary

In Block107847
TimeWed, 22 Mar 2023 02:00:30 UTC
Total Input535.35830369 Nebula
Total Output590.35830369 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
574016 Confirmations590.35830369 Nebula
Raw Transaction